[Bug 1879350] Re: need uc20 grade=dangerous channel=beta images built

Launchpad Bug Tracker 1879350 at bugs.launchpad.net
Thu Jul 23 11:28:16 UTC 2020


This bug was fixed in the package livecd-rootfs - 2.664.3

---------------
livecd-rootfs (2.664.3) focal; urgency=medium

  [ Ɓukasz 'sil2100' Zemczak ]
  * Enable overrides of UC20 grade dangerous channels - as this is possible.
    (LP: #1879350)

  [ Iain Lane ]
  * Hack seeding of linux kernel in ubuntustudio/focal
    ubuntustudio-default-settings in focal release has a Recommends to this
    kernel, which makes it impossible to update the kernel later on, since we
    would install the -updates and release kernel, which isn't allowed and
    causes FTBFS. Hack out the focal-release kernel and let the rest of the
    build process pull in the right one. (LP: #1884915)

 -- Iain Lane <iain.lane at canonical.com>  Tue, 21 Jul 2020 16:25:18 +0100

** Changed in: livecd-rootfs (Ubuntu Focal)
       Status: Fix Committed => Fix Released

-- 
You received this bug notification because you are a member of Ubuntu
Foundations Bugs, which is subscribed to livecd-rootfs in Ubuntu.
https://bugs.launchpad.net/bugs/1879350

Title:
  need uc20 grade=dangerous channel=beta images built

Status in Ubuntu CD Images:
  Fix Released
Status in livecd-rootfs package in Ubuntu:
  Fix Released
Status in livecd-rootfs source package in Focal:
  Fix Released

Bug description:
  [Impact]

  We need the ability to build arbitrary-risk-level dangerous images for
  UC20.

  [Test Case]

  Fire up a livefs build of ubuntu-core on focal using the -proposed
  version of livecd-rootfs, with CHANNEL=dangerous-beta and observe if
  the build succeeds, with the dangerous model being used and the
  channel overriden to beta.

  [Regression Potential]

  UC20 builds can be potentially affected for unrelated channel
  combinations. That being said, the exact same change is being used for
  UC20 builds since long (via the snappy PPA) and no regressions have
  been observed.

  [Original Description]

  We need the following things:

  1. canonical signed model assertions for a uc20 image with grade==dangerous, channel==beta for the various supported platforms, i.e. right now generic pc-kernel amd64 and armhf pi-kernel and arm64 pi-kernel models
  2. livcd-rootfs + cdimage builds of images for the above model assertions
  3. somehow these builds get published onto http://cdimage.ubuntu.com/ubuntu-core/20/dangerous-beta/ (or some other new directory there that does not conflict with the current set of dangerous, edge and beta)

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u-cdimage/+bug/1879350/+subscriptions



More information about the foundations-bugs mailing list